Técnicas Reunidas Bags Two Brownfield Projects with Saudi Aramco

February 18, 2021 | Oil & Gas | Energy Facts Staff Writer | 4min

Técnicas Reunidas has signed a six years long-term agreement (LTA) with Saudi
Aramco, thus joining the exclusive group of eight contractors that signed this same framework agreement a few week ago.

This LTA contract is part of Aramco’s new contracting strategy and is aimed at improving cost efficiency and the quality and safety of its oil and gas brownfield and plan upgrade projects and to pioneer environmental sustainability fundamentals. It also focuses on establishing new businesses and developing partnerships based on sustainability and new technologies.

The scope of the LTA includes engineering, procurement, construction, start up and precommissioning of each project, as well as the installation of the upgraded facilities in the designated operating areas.

With the signing of this agreement, Saudi Aramco and Técnicas Reunidas will support growth in employment and the development of the workforce in Saudi Arabia, with a special emphasis on improving Saudization, local content and supply chains, contributing to the fulfillment of the objectives within the “In Kingdom Total Value Add” (IKTVA) program of Saudi Aramco.
